How to Dry Firewood Fast: 5 Pro Tips for Faster Seasoning
Seasoning firewood is the process of reducing the moisture content of freshly cut wood (also known as green wood) to a level suitable for burning efficiently and cleanly. Green wood can have a moisture content as high as 50% or even more. Properly seasoned firewood, on the other hand, should have a moisture content of around 20% or less. Burning unseasoned wood leads to a host of problems:
- Reduced Heat Output: A significant portion of the fire’s energy is used to boil off the water in the wood, resulting in less heat available to warm your home.
- Increased Smoke: Wet wood produces excessive smoke, which can be irritating and harmful to breathe.
- Creosote Buildup: Unseasoned wood contributes to the buildup of creosote in your chimney, a flammable substance that can lead to dangerous chimney fires.
- Inefficient Burning: Wet wood burns incompletely, leading to wasted fuel and increased air pollution.

1. Choose the Right Wood Species for Faster Drying
Not all firewood is created equal. The species of wood you choose has a significant impact on how quickly it seasons. Dense hardwoods, like oak and maple, are prized for their high heat output, but they also take longer to dry. Softer woods, like pine and poplar, season much faster but burn quicker.
- Hardwoods (Oak, Maple, Ash, Beech): These are the king of firewood, providing long-lasting heat. However, they can take 6-12 months to season properly. I often tell people that oak is an investment – it takes time, but the payoff in heat and burn time is worth it.
- Softwoods (Pine, Fir, Spruce, Poplar): These dry much faster, often in 3-6 months, making them a good option if you need firewood quickly. However, they burn faster and produce more smoke than hardwoods. I’ve used pine as a “starter” wood to get a fire going quickly, then added hardwoods for sustained heat.

2. Split the Wood as Soon as Possible
Splitting firewood dramatically increases the surface area exposed to air, accelerating the drying process. Whole logs retain moisture for much longer. The sooner you split the wood after felling the tree, the better.
- Why Splitting Matters: Splitting creates more surfaces for moisture to escape. Think of it like this: a whole apple takes much longer to dry out than apple slices.
- Timing is Key: Green wood is easier to split than seasoned wood. As wood dries, it becomes harder and more resistant to splitting.
- Splitting Tools: You can use a maul, axe, or a hydraulic log splitter. I’ve used all three, and while a maul provides a good workout, a log splitter is a lifesaver for large quantities of wood or particularly stubborn logs.

3. Stack Firewood Properly for Optimal Airflow
Proper stacking is crucial for allowing air to circulate around the wood, carrying away moisture. The goal is to create a stack that is stable, allows for good airflow, and maximizes sun exposure.
- Elevated Stacking: Stack your firewood on pallets, racks, or even scrap lumber to keep it off the ground. This prevents moisture from wicking up from the soil.
- Single Row vs. Multiple Rows: Single rows allow for the best airflow, but they can be unstable. Multiple rows are more stable but require more space between rows for adequate air circulation.
- “Criss-Cross” Stacking: Start and end your stacks with a criss-cross pattern for added stability.
- Sun Exposure: Position your woodpile in a sunny location to maximize the drying effect of the sun.

4. Maximize Sun and Wind Exposure
Sun and wind are your allies in the fight against moisture. The more sun and wind your firewood receives, the faster it will dry.
- Strategic Placement: Choose a location for your woodpile that receives direct sunlight for most of the day. South-facing locations are ideal in the Northern Hemisphere.
- Wind Breaks: Avoid placing your woodpile in areas that are sheltered from the wind. Wind helps to evaporate moisture from the wood’s surface.
- Removing Obstructions: Trim back any trees or shrubs that might be blocking sunlight or wind.

5. Consider Kiln Drying for the Fastest Results (But at a Cost)
Kiln drying is the fastest way to season firewood. It involves placing the wood in a large oven and using heat to evaporate the moisture. Kiln-dried firewood typically has a moisture content of 15-20%, making it ideal for burning.
- Advantages of Kiln Drying:
- Speed: Kiln drying can season firewood in a matter of days, compared to months for air drying.
- Consistency: Kiln-dried firewood has a consistent moisture content, ensuring optimal burning performance.
- Pest Control: The high heat of the kiln kills any insects or fungi that might be present in the wood.
- Disadvantages of Kiln Drying:
- Cost: Kiln-dried firewood is significantly more expensive than air-dried firewood.
- Availability: Kiln-dried firewood may not be readily available in all areas.

Factors Affecting Firewood Costs
Several factors contribute to the price of firewood, including:
- Wood Species: As mentioned earlier, hardwoods are generally more expensive than softwoods due to their higher heat output and longer burn time.
- Seasoning: Seasoned firewood commands a higher price than green wood.
- Quantity: Firewood is typically sold by the cord or fraction of a cord. A cord is a stacked pile of wood measuring 4 feet high, 4 feet wide, and 8 feet long (128 cubic feet).
- Location: Firewood prices vary significantly depending on your location. Areas with abundant forests tend to have lower prices than areas where firewood is scarce.
- Delivery: Delivery charges can add significantly to the overall cost of firewood.
- Splitting: Pre-split firewood is more expensive than unsplit logs.
- Demand: Firewood prices tend to increase during the winter months when demand is highest.
